It sounds like a strange word, but let's look at it's prefix. Mono mial - the prefix mono means one. A monomial is one term. In the equations unit, we said that terms were separated by a plus sign or a minus sign. Therefore:A polynomial as oppose to the monomial is a sum of monomials where each monomial is called a term. The degree of the polynomial is the greatest degree of its terms. FOIL is just an acronym that people use when they first start multiplying things like (6+7) (3+5). It stands for First Outer Inner Last. But you do not have to follow that method like PEMDAS. Later on, you will learn the Distributive Property for solving equations ...If you multiply binomials often enough you may notice a pattern. Notice that the first term in the result is the product of the first terms in each binomial. The second and third terms are the product of multiplying the two outer terms and then the two inner terms. And the last term results from multiplying the two last terms,. Jun 5, 2023 · Fortunately, multiplying a polynomial by a monomial is almost the same thing as multiplying monomials; we simply do it several times. The instruction is as follows: multiply the monomial by each term (i.e., each monomial) of the polynomial and add it all together. What 6 formulas are used for the Monomials Calculator?The total number of products we need to calculate is equal to the product of the number of terms in each polynomial. Multiplying two binomials requires 2 ⋅ 2 = 4 ‍ products, as shown above. Multiplying a monomial and a trinomial requires 1 ⋅ 3 = 3 ‍ products; multiplying a binomial and a trinomial requires 2 ⋅ 3 = 6 ‍ products.A monomial is an algebraic expression that consists of only one term. To multiply two polynomials, you use the distributive property so that every term in the first factor is multiplied by every term in the second factor.
